The founder of Bitzlato was taken into custody by the Department of Justice (DOJ) of the United States in one of the most significant worldwide cryptocurrency enforcement actions. 

According to DOJ sources, the crypto exchange is actively helping facilitate cryptocurrency crime. Interestingly, it is not Binance but a Chinese cryptocurrency exchange. The criticized business began doing business internationally in 2016 and had its Hong Kong registration.

The DOJ claims that the arrested Bitzlato founder was involved in providing services to financial offenders. Several federal agencies, including the FBI, OFAC, and the Financial Crimes Enforcement Network, collaborated on it (FinCEN).

These groups have been working nonstop to keep an eye out for questionable activity among financial firms.

Bitzlato-fueled darknet marketplaces

The federal agencies accuse Bitzlato of facilitating ransomware attacks and running darknet marketplaces. They also facilitate ransomware operations.


They estimate that direct and indirect unlawful transfers related to the ransomware total more than $700 million. The majority of these transactions occurred between 2018 and last year.

The US government stated in a press conference that coordinated actions like those against Bitzlato are essential to the fight against cybercrime on a global scale. The crypto lord apprehended has been identified as Anatoly Legkodymov, a Russian residing in China. But he was detained in Miami, Florida, in the US.

Legkodymov's cryptocurrency exchange, Bitzlato, disregarded the necessary anti-money-laundering protections. Also, as confirmed by the US department, they allowed users to provide information for registrants who were not real, or straw men, customers.

The main charge against this cryptocurrency exchange is that it offered anonymous transactions to criminals and drug dealers.
